The Mondelez moves the production of Negro sweets to Turkey
The Mondelez International, snack maker company will relocate the production of Negro sweets to the plant into Gebze, Turkey by the end of June next year. So the sugar factory operated by Győri Keksz Kft. in Győr ends its operations – the Mondelez Hungária Kft. and the Communications Adviser of the Győri Keksz Kft. informed MTI on Thursday.
Kertész Péter said that the 35 people working in the factory were informed on Thursday about the decision of the factory management. By the end of October, the relocation of the production of the Halls candies will be completed to the company’s new candy and chewing gum factory in Skarmibierz, Poland. This step was announced at the beginning of 2016. (MTI)
